Rubber roof repair services involve the inspection, maintenance, and restoration of rubber roofing systems, commonly known as EPDM (ethylene propylene diene monomer) roofs. These services typically include patching leaks, sealing cracks, and replacing damaged sections to ensure the roof maintains its waterproof barrier. Repair professionals assess the condition of the rubber membrane, identify areas of wear or damage, and apply specialized materials to restore the roof’s integrity. Proper repair work can extend the lifespan of a rubber roof and help prevent more extensive damage that could lead to costly replacements.
Rubber roof repair addresses common problems such as leaks, tears, cracks, and blistering that can develop over time. These issues often arise due to exposure to weather elements, UV rays, or physical impacts. Repair services help resolve these problems by sealing vulnerable spots, reinforcing weak areas, and preventing water infiltration. By addressing issues early, property owners can avoid the deterioration of underlying structures, mold growth, and interior water damage, which can be costly and disruptive.

Material and Size - The cost of rubber roof repairs varies based on the size and material quality. Typical expenses range from $300 to $1,500 for small to medium patches. Larger repairs or high-quality materials can increase costs accordingly.
Repair Type - Simple patch repairs tend to be more affordable, usually between $200 and $600. Extensive repairs or complete sections replaced may cost $1,000 or more, depending on complexity.
Labor and Accessibility - Labor costs depend on the repair's difficulty and accessibility of the roof. Expect to pay between $50 and $100 per hour, with total costs influenced by the repair's scope.

What are common signs that a rubber roof need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, blisters, ponding water, and membrane deterioration that may indicate the need for professional inspection and repair.
How long does rubber roof rep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a day by experienced service providers.
Can rubber roofs be repaired instead of replaced? Yes, many issues such as leaks or minor damage can often be fixed through repairs, extending the roof's lifespan without full replacement.
What types of repairs do local rubber roof service providers offer? Services may include patching leaks, sealing cracks, replacing damaged sections, and performing preventative maintenance.
